The Basics of Memory Reconsolidation

At its core, memory reconsolidation involves a fascinating neurological ballet, where the act of recalling a memory places it in a flexible, malleable state. It’s during this phase that a memory, which might have been as rigid as granite, becomes as pliable as putty. This window of opportunity allows for the memory to be modified before it’s saved again—an aspect that, quite frankly, sounds as if it’s been plucked straight from science fiction.

Imagine, if you will, a memory tied to a significant trigger of anxiety. Each time this memory is activated, the emotional and physiological responses associated with it are re-experienced. However, through the lens of memory reconsolidation, this process is not just a curse but a potential key to healing. By intentionally recalling these memories in a therapeutic setting and introducing new, positive information or perspectives, the memory can be “rewritten” and saved with less of its anxiety-inducing power.

The Practical Application in Therapy

So, how does this relate to the nitty-gritty of treating anxiety? Let’s dive into some applications:

  •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and Beyond: Traditional CBT might inadvertently tap into the principles of memory reconsolidation, as it challenges and changes the thought patterns related to anxiety-inducing memories. By purposefully incorporating techniques that target memory reconsolidation, therapists can supercharge the effectiveness of these sessions.

  • Exposure Therapy with a Twist: Exposure therapy, a cornerstone in treating phobias and PTSD, can be enhanced by focusing on the reconsolidation window. By carefully guiding a patient to recall their fears within a safe environment and then introducing positive or neutral outcomes, the fearful memory can lose some of its stings.

  • Mindfulness and Memory: Mindfulness practices can serve as an ally to memory reconsolidation by creating a grounded, calm state from which to explore painful memories. By achieving a state of calm, the contrast between the recalled memory and the present reality can be more starkly presented, aiding in the reconsolidation process.
